The vehicle took a hit to the drivers front corner. The front airbags are deployed and both front seat belts are seized up. The windshield is cracked and needs replacement. The is no frame damage on the Lincoln, only the inner structure is damaged. The shock tower appear to be in the correct position and the drivers front door opens and closes perfectly. There is no damage to the cooling, engine, transmission or suspension. We did replace the drivers knee assembly and axle shaft with a new take off parts. All of the body damage is clearly visible in the photos. This Lincoln runs and lot drives well in its current condition.
